The Shift Towards Mobile-Centric Crypto Platforms

Recent industry data underscores a significant transformation: over 73% of retail crypto traders now prefer to interact with exchanges via mobile devices (Source: Crypto Insights 2023). This trend reflects broader societal shifts, where smartphones have become central to financial decision-making, enabling traders to monitor markets, execute transactions, and manage assets on the go.

However, this shift presents critical challenges for digital asset management platforms: how to deliver fast, secure, and intuitive experiences on a variety of mobile devices. The answer lies in adaptive, innovative design and cutting-edge infrastructure, which is why robust mobile platforms are now a differentiator in the crowded crypto arena.

The Critical Role of Mobile Optimization in Digital Asset Platforms

Optimal mobile design impacts various facets of crypto trading:

  • Security: Mobile platforms must incorporate multi-factor authentication and secure encryption to protect assets. With mobile breaches increasing by 45% year-over-year, security cannot be an afterthought (Cybersecurity Journal, 2023).
  • Speed: Quick load times and smooth interfaces are essential for real-time trading decisions.
  • User Experience: Intuitive navigation and functionality foster trust and reduce cognitive load, especially vital in volatile markets.

Platforms that neglect mobile performance risk alienating users and exposing themselves to vulnerabilities. This makes mobile-first design an imperative rather than an option.

Innovations in Mobile Asset Management Platforms

Feature Impact
Responsive UI Ensures consistent experience across devices, increasing engagement.
Progressive Web Apps (PWAs) Combine the reach of the web with app-like stability, reducing reliance on app stores.
Biometric Security Offers quick, secure access—fingerprint or facial recognition—critical for high-frequency trading.
Instant Push Notifications Keep traders informed of market movements instantly, enabling rapid decisions.

Case Study: How Leading Platforms Embrace Mobile

Major exchanges, including Coinbase and Binance, have invested heavily in their mobile offerings. For example, Coinbase’s mobile app now accounts for over 60% of its transaction volume, highlighting user preference for on-the-go trading. Their platform integrates secure biometric login, real-time alerts, and a simplified UI—principles that have driven higher retention rates and trading volume.

Emerging Best Practices and Future Trends

Next-generation platforms are exploring:

  • Artificial Intelligence (AI): Personalised trading advice via mobile interfaces, improving accessibility for novice traders.
  • Decentralized Wallets: Enhancing control and security of assets on mobile devices without relying on centralized entities.
  • Enhanced Data Visualization: Interactive charts and analytics tailored for mobile screens.

In this context, ensuring a refined, reliable interface across all mobile devices becomes essential to stakeholder confidence and industry credibility.
